Aquaman surges forward on this Trevor McCarthy cover, trident raised and crackling with electric blue energy, his dark armor torn as water and lightning swirl around him — every detail screaming defiance from a king stripped of his throne. Written by Cullen Bunn with art by Vicente Cifuentes, *Exiled* is the seventh New 52 collection that puts Arthur Curry at his most desperate and combative. If you've ever wanted to see Aquaman fight back against impossible odds with nothing but sheer will and a golden trident, this volume makes a strong case.
